FLAMSTEED, John (1649-1719). Atlas céleste. Paris: F.G. Deschamps, 1776.

Elegant small French edition of Flamsteed, the first revised edition, edited by J. Fortin under the aegis of the Académie Royale des Sciences. Stated second edition. "In 1776, the French globe maker Jean Fortin (1750–1831?) produced the first revision of Flamsteed’s atlas, increasing the number of charts, improving the aesthetic appeal of Flamsteed’s original figures, and reducing the size of the volume dramatically." Hammond, p. 81.

Quarto (222 x 162mm). With 30 double-page engraved star maps on guards (spotting, particularly to text and to first few plates). Contemporary paste-paper boards (rebacked in modern calf, worn, few tears to endpapers). Provenance: few early manuscript notes to list of engravings – Alfred N. Pray (ownership stamp on front free endpaper). Custom clamshell box.
